You know what else was wonderful this week? Fourth of July. I’ve always loved this holiday. It’s a time where everyone embraces color coordinating outfits, dancing, and sparklers. Last year, I shared my experiences with starting the dancing, and although that didn’t happen this year, I did have a similar experience…

My friends and I were in Annapolis, standing on a bridge and watching the fireworks explode over the water. A girl in a group next to us started humming “The Star Spangled Banner”, and I started singing it louder and we ended up having a bunch of people on our side of the bridge singing that song, dressed in red, white, and blue, watching beautiful bursts of light. I enjoyed the comradery of the moment.
